Algeria: President Tebboune returns to Germany because of the Covid-19

 

Algerian President Abdelmadjid Tebboune is not yet done with Covid-19. He has just returned to Germany after returning only two weeks ago after a two-month stay. No details were disclosed on the duration of the new medical stay of the Algerian president in Germany. President Tebboune, 75, returned from Berlin on December 29 after hospitalization, followed by convalescence, after contracting the coronavirus in October in Algiers.

Information provided by public television

National television broadcast images of the head of state in the honor lounge of the Boufarik military airport, near Algiers, where he was greeted by senior state officials before taking off. for Berlin. According to television, Mr. Tebboune was to undergo foot care before his return to Algeria, but as they were not of an urgent nature, they had been postponed due to the president’s commitments related to the treatment of certain “urgent cases. “. The head of state had to return to Algiers in order to sign the 2021 finance law before December 31 and to promulgate the revision of the Constitution adopted by referendum on the 1is November.
